Medium term:  I'll be adding incoming-message handling to the dll
plugin, and probably port-level connect/listen/send/receive services
to net plugin.

Shorter term: winLirc source code is apparently frozen, having not
been altered since 2002-07-13.

So, it would be a simle matter to strip out the bits of winLirc that
communicate via a port (which is a bit insecure anyway) and replace
them with direct communication with powerpro.  So to either get
signals from IR devices or send IR signals emulating IR devices, you just
set up some config info for ppWinLirc, and run it.

But: I have no IR capability on my machine, so won;t do this unless
there's someone who has IR hardware (ideally in and out) and is
willing to test the modified winLirc.
